The first standards were attempted in 1864 in Oxford and Cambridge: The length of the course was set to 120yards (109.7 m) and over its course, runners were required to clear ten 42 inches (106.7cm) high hurdles; the height and spacing of the hurdles have been related to Imperial units ever since. The current running style where the first hurdle is taken on the run with the upper body lowered instead of being jumped over and with three steps each between the hurdles was first used by the 1900 Olympic champion, Alvin Kraenzlein. For the first hurdles races in England around 1830, wooden barriers were placed along a stretch of 100yards (91.44m). The next nine hurdles are set at a distance of 9.14metres (30ft) from each other, and the home stretch from the last hurdle to the finish line is 14.02metres (46ft) long. Athletes compete in lanes and start in blocks, negotiating 10 hurdles of 3ft 6in (107cm). For the 110m hurdles, the first hurdle is placed after a run-up of 13.72metres (45ft) from the starting line.
